§ 4012. Payment for hospice.

1.No government agency shall purchase,\npay for or make reimbursement or grants-in-aid for services provided by\na hospice unless, at the time the services were provided, the hospice\npossessed a valid certificate of approval.\n 2. Payments for hospice care made by government agencies shall be at\nrates approved by the state director of the budget.\n 3. Prior to the approval of hospice rates, the commissioner shall\ndetermine and certify to the state director of the budget that the\nproposed rate schedules for payments for hospice services are reasonable\nand adequate to meet the costs which must be incurred by efficiently and\neconomically operated programs.
